It is not known whether the gray dwarves migrated to the Caves of Infinity or if their more civilized cousins fled their brutish cousins. Tyrannical, grim, industrious and pessimistic, the lives of the gray dwarves are bleak and brutal. Rather than a flaw, however, they view their lack of happiness as their greatest strength, the defining feature of their pride. The gray dwarves saw themselves as the true paragons of dwarvish ideals compared to their weak and pampered kin, but in truth, their ways were a dark reflection of those found in normal dwarves While they do display the redeeming virtues of determination and bravery, the grays take dwarven flaws to their logical extremes. They are violent and hateful, sullen and insular, greedy and ungrateful, deeply cynical of others' motives and dutifully track and nurse every grudge, whether or not any offense was meant. Though their vices were many, the moral failings of the gray dwarves could be traced to three primary principles: bottomless greed, unceasing conflict, and rejection of emotion.
